    Hi, I'm trying to compile a list of alternative British comedy from the 90s onwards. I'm specifically looking for ALTERNATIVE style shows and they must be BRITISH. The list I've compiled so far should give you an idea of the style I'm looking for. To give you some idea, I've not included great shows like Early Doors and The Royle Family or things like Coupling because they're far closer to traditional sitcoms that the sort of material I'm looking for. Still, if you have any suggestions please don't hesitate to add them. Here's my current list:
